Combating Corrosion with Eco-Friendly Practices

Minimizing corrosion's detrimental effects on infrastructure and industrial equipment is vital. Implementing eco-friendly practices presents a green approach to achieve this goal. Utilizing innovative materials that exhibit inherent resistance to corrosion can significantly reduce the need for protective coatings, thereby minimizing waste and environmental impact. Furthermore, embracing sustainable energy sources for industrial processes can mitigate greenhouse gas emissions associated with traditional energy production methods that often contribute to corrosion. By embracing these eco-friendly practices, we can strive towards a future where corrosion control is both efficient and environmentally aware.

Protective Coatings for a Greener Tomorrow

As the global community's demands escalate, the need for sustainable solutions in every sector becomes ever more pressing. Within these efforts lies the crucial role of anti-corrosive coatings, which serve to extending the lifespan of infrastructure and equipment, but also reduce the environmental impact associated with creation. By implementing advanced coating technologies, we can materially reduce the necessity for frequent replacements, thereby conserving resources and mitigating waste.

As a result, the development and adoption of innovative anti-corrosive coatings represent a proactive step towards a more sustainable future, benefiting a greener tomorrow.
